Enterprise Business & Technology Modernization is a cross-functional organization leading the Propel program, a major business and technology modernization initiative designed to unlock customer value by simplifying collaborative work processes. Propel will migrate the organization to the new version of SAP, S/4HANA, presenting a unique opportunity to standardize business processes, clean the technology core, and enable innovation for breakthrough change across Engineering, Operations, Finance, Supply Chain, Human Resources, and Information Technology. Through a phased approach, Propel will implement process standardization, operating model changes, data improvements, SAP, and other technology applications with a focus on incrementally improving business capabilities and delivering value.
Enterprise Business & Technology Modernization is comprised of multi-disciplinary coworkers with deep functional and industry expertise to design and implement end-to-end business processes and technology solutions following industry-leading practices. The team partners closely with IT and external partners to work collaboratively with many stakeholders to adopt standard processes and maximize the use of out-of-the-box proven technology solutions to meet business needs. The Supply Chain Management Data Lead (Systems Analyst, Principal) will play a pivotal role in the Propel program, leading the data workstream within the Supply Chain functional team. This role will have accountability to execute Propel Program master data governance efforts for the Supply Chain functional workstream, provide sign-off around data conversion strategy, data governance plan, data retention and archiving, reporting, data quality assessment, and data cleansing approach and plan. This role requires a deep understanding of core SAP SCM modules MM (Material Management) and EWM (Extended Warehouse Management) as well as extended Procurement solutions Ariba, Fieldglass, and Icertis. The ideal candidate will possess the ability to drive cross-functional collaboration to achieve strategic objectives and will be responsible for ensuring alignment with Supply Chain and Propel's goals of standardizing business processes, enhancing data quality, and enabling technological innovation for the future state STP design. This position is hybrid, working from your remote office and Oakland on business needs or company requirements.
This opportunity is a key leadership role within the Propel program, which is currently driving the transformation from SAP ECC to S/4HANA. The position serves as a strategic liaison across the PMO, Propel program team, Center of Excellence (COE), Master Data organization, and Supply Chain functions, ensuring alignment between business objectives, data strategy, and system implementation. The role will initially be an individual contributor position focused on strategy, data governance, and analytics leadership, with the expectation of evolving into a people leadership role responsible for building and managing a team.
